How AI Supports Innovation in Small Businesses


Jonathan Reed October 3, 2025

Artificial Intelligence (AI) has transformed the business landscape, enabling organizations to analyze data, automate processes, and enhance decision-making. Small businesses, which often operate with limited resources, can leverage AI to innovate efficiently and compete with larger enterprises. According to McKinsey & Company, AI adoption helps businesses identify growth opportunities, optimize operations, and respond quickly to market trends. By integrating AI into daily operations, small businesses can enhance productivity, improve customer experiences, and develop innovative products and services.

Automating Routine Operations

One of the most immediate benefits of AI for small businesses is process automation. Tasks that once consumed significant time and resources—such as data entry, scheduling, and customer service—can now be handled by AI-powered tools. Examples include:

  • Chatbots: Provide instant customer support and handle frequently asked questions, freeing employees for higher-value tasks.
  • AI-driven accounting software: Automates invoicing, expense tracking, and financial reporting.
  • Inventory management systems: Use predictive analytics to optimize stock levels and reduce waste.
    Automation reduces operational costs, minimizes human error, and allows small business owners to focus on strategic growth initiatives.

Enhancing Customer Experience

AI enables small businesses to understand and engage customers more effectively. Personalized experiences are a key driver of customer loyalty and competitive advantage. Techniques include:

  • Recommendation engines: Suggest products or services based on customer preferences and previous behavior.
  • Sentiment analysis: Monitors social media and reviews to gauge customer satisfaction and identify areas for improvement.
  • Predictive analytics: Anticipates customer needs and provides timely, relevant offers.
    By leveraging AI to tailor customer interactions, small businesses can build stronger relationships, increase retention, and drive revenue growth.

Supporting Data-Driven Decision Making

Data is a valuable asset for innovation, but small businesses often lack the resources to process and analyze large datasets. AI tools provide insights that guide strategic decisions, including market expansion, pricing strategies, and product development. Benefits include:

  • Identifying emerging trends and consumer preferences
  • Detecting inefficiencies and areas for process improvement
  • Optimizing marketing campaigns based on predictive analytics
    AI-driven analytics empowers small businesses to make informed, timely decisions that foster innovation and reduce the risk of costly mistakes.

Facilitating Product and Service Innovation

AI can inspire innovation in product and service offerings. By analyzing customer feedback, market data, and competitor activity, businesses can identify unmet needs and opportunities for differentiation. Applications include:

  • AI-powered design tools: Generate prototypes or product variations quickly, reducing development time.
  • Market simulations: Test different pricing or service scenarios to identify optimal strategies.
  • Voice or image recognition technologies: Enable new service features such as visual search or automated customer assistance.
    Integrating AI into the innovation process allows small businesses to develop unique offerings while maintaining agility and cost efficiency.

Enhancing Marketing and Sales Strategies

AI supports small business growth through smarter marketing and sales initiatives. Marketing automation platforms, predictive analytics, and AI-driven content creation help businesses reach the right audience with personalized messaging. Strategies include:

  • Targeted advertising: AI identifies high-potential customer segments and optimizes ad placement.
  • Email automation and personalization: Delivers customized content based on behavior and preferences.
  • Sales forecasting: Predicts demand, enabling better inventory and staffing decisions.
    By combining AI insights with human creativity, small businesses can increase engagement, conversions, and revenue.

Optimizing Supply Chain and Operations

Small businesses can also benefit from AI in supply chain and operational management. Predictive analytics, demand forecasting, and real-time monitoring improve efficiency and reduce costs. Key applications include:

  • Inventory optimization: AI predicts stock requirements, minimizing overstock or stockouts.
  • Route optimization: Delivery and logistics are streamlined using AI-powered mapping and traffic analysis.
  • Quality control: AI detects defects and anomalies in products, improving overall quality.
    Efficient operations create more capacity for innovation, allowing small businesses to reinvest resources in growth initiatives.

Reducing Risk and Ensuring Compliance

AI can assist small businesses in risk management and regulatory compliance. Fraud detection algorithms, automated reporting, and compliance monitoring reduce exposure to legal and financial risks. Examples include:

  • Detecting unusual transactions in real time to prevent fraud
  • Monitoring regulatory changes and automatically updating procedures
  • Using AI-powered tools to ensure data privacy and cybersecurity compliance
    By mitigating risks through AI, small businesses can operate more confidently and focus on innovation.

Overcoming Challenges in AI Adoption

Despite the benefits, small businesses face challenges when adopting AI, such as cost, lack of technical expertise, and integration with existing systems. Strategies to overcome these challenges include:

  • Leveraging cloud-based AI solutions with scalable pricing models
  • Collaborating with AI consultants or local tech incubators
  • Providing staff training and upskilling opportunities
  • Starting with small pilot projects to demonstrate value before full-scale implementation
    Addressing these challenges ensures that AI adoption is sustainable and delivers tangible innovation outcomes.

The Future of AI in Small Business Innovation

The role of AI in small business innovation will continue to grow. Emerging trends include:

  • Generative AI for content and design: Automates creative processes for marketing, product design, and customer engagement.
  • AI-driven decision support: Advanced analytics for real-time strategy adjustments.
  • Integration with IoT devices: Enhances operational monitoring and automation in small-scale manufacturing or retail operations.
    As AI tools become more accessible and user-friendly, small businesses will increasingly leverage them to drive innovation, improve efficiency, and remain competitive in rapidly evolving markets.
